iSpot

iSpot is a Web site aimed at helping anyone identify anything in nature. Once you've registered, you can add an observation to the Web site and suggest an identification yourself or see if anyone else can identify it for you. Members of the Amateur Entomologists' Society are very active on iSpot providing identifications in a variety of areas. Visit: https://www.ispotnature.org/

iNaturalist

If you are outside the UK then iNaturalist provides a place to record and organise nature findings, meet other nature enthusiasts, and learn about the natural world. Visit: https://www.inaturalist.org/
